Honors Program Create & Solve Puzzles for Computing Class

Friday, May 5, 2017

In Professor Zack Butler’s honors course, Puzzles For Computing, students are learning algorithms to both solve and create puzzles. They explore how human strategies can be encoded in a program, and how human puzzle authors can work together with computer programs to create puzzles that are more interesting than either could construct on their own. Students are investigating logic puzzles, math puzzles, word puzzles, and even brand-new puzzle styles that they are designing. Students will team up to create a puzzle hunt (in the style of the MIT Mystery Hunt or Microsoft Puzzle Challenge) that will be solved and critiqued by another team in the class.